I also recommend checking the log_mtts_per_set parameter to the mlx4 module. 
This parameter controls how much memory can be registered for use by the mlx4 
driver and it should be in the range 1-5 (or 0-7 depending on the version of 
the mlx4 driver). I recommend tthe parameter be set such that you can register 
all the memory on the node. Assuming you are not using huge pages here is a 
list of possible values (and how much memory can be registered).

0 -   2 GB (new mlx4 default-- bad setting)
1 -   4 GB
2 -   8 GB
3 -  16 GB (old mlx4 default)
4 -  32 GB
5 -  64 GB
6 - 128 GB
7 - 256 GB

This problem can be  caused by a variety of things, but I suspect our default 
queue pair parameters (QP) aren't helping the
situation :-).

What happens when you add the following to your mpirun command?

-mca btl_openib_receive_queues S,4096,128:S,12288,128:S,65536,12

OMPI Developers:

Maybe we should consider disabling the use of per-peer queue pairs by default.  
Do they buy us anything?  For what it is
worth, we have stopped using them on all of our large systems here at LANL.

      I am getting this error message below and I don’t know what it means or 
how to fix it.   It only happens when I
      run on a large number of processes, e.g. 960.  Things work fine on 480, 
and I don’t think the application has a
      bug.  Any help is appreciated…

[c1n01][[30697,1],3][connect/btl_openib_connect_oob.c:464:qp_create_one] error 
creating qp errno says Cannot allocate
memory
[c1n01][[30697,1],4][connect/btl_openib_connect_oob.c:464:qp_create_one] error 
creating qp errno says Cannot allocate
memory

Here’s the mpirun command I used:
mpirun --prefix /usr/mpi/intel/openmpi-1.4.3 --machinefile <host file> -np 960 
--mca btl ^tcp --mca
mpool_base_use_mem_hooks 1 --mca mpi_leave_pinned 1 -x LD_LIBRARY_PATH -x 
MPI_ENVIRONMENT=1 <application name +
arguments>
